Laughing at the News: Comedy Writers Speak

by Mike Hall, May 5, 2009

Jon Stewart or Katie Couric? Jay Leno or Charles Gibson? David Letterman or Brian Williams? A growing number of people are choosing Jon, Jay and David as their sources for news while the anchor class and newsmakers are turning up more often on the late night sets and in the skits.

On Friday at 7:30 p.m. at the Newseum in Washington, D.C., the Writers Guild of America, East (WGAE) will explore this change in the public’s news consuming habits and the

growing synergy between Washington, Wall Street, the media, and the late night comedy/variety programs.
